Material Selection by Project Type
- Driveways: Crusher run works well as a compactable base and surface. A base layer of larger stone may help on soft ground or long driveways.
- Drainage: Crushed Stone or drain rock is the best choice because it allows water to flow freely. Material with fines can clog.
- Patios and walkways: Use a compacted base of paver base or crusher run. Then add a thin layer of stone screenings or sand for leveling.
- Landscape beds and soil work: Decorative stone or mulch covers beds and reduces weeds. Top soil or garden soil supports new planting.
Local Conditions That Affect Material Choice
Strafford County has a mix of rural farmlands, wooded acreage, and compact suburban lots. Driveways and access roads vary from short paved entries to long unpaved lanes.
Soils in the county range from fast-draining Top Soil to heavier clay that holds moisture after rain. Freeze-thaw cycles can shift materials, so a stable base matters for driveways and patios.
Sloped properties may need extra drainage planning. Clean stone or a layered base helps manage runoff and prevents erosion on hillsides.
Delivery and Access in Strafford County
Delivery planning in Strafford County depends on the property layout, truck access, and drop location. Rural driveways, tight turns, steep grades, soft ground, and overhead clearance can affect the truck size or unloading point.
Before scheduling, customers should know where the material should be dropped, whether the truck can turn around, and whether the driveway or job site can handle the load.

What aggregate is best for a residential driveway in Strafford County?
Crusher run is the most common choice. It compacts well and provides a stable surface. On soft ground, a base layer of larger stone may help.
What is the difference between crusher run and Crushed Stone?
Crusher run contains fines that help it compact into a solid surface. Crushed Stone has no fines, so it drains water and stays loose. Use crusher run for driveways and clean stone for drainage.
